About this role
An optical assistant in a practice environment like Boots Opticians FR (Mere Green) in Birmingham is integral to daily operations. This role involves being the initial point of contact for patients, managing appointment schedules, and ensuring a welcoming atmosphere. Key responsibilities include conducting essential pre-screening tests such as autorefraction, tonometry, and visual field tests. Furthermore, optical assistants support patients in selecting eyewear, perform minor frame adjustments and repairs, and process customer orders accurately. Maintaining the tidiness and presentation of the practice floor is also a crucial aspect of the position, contributing significantly to the overall efficiency and patient experience.
What working in a role like this could offer you
What working in a role like this could offer you is a stable career path within a resilient sector. Opportunities for professional growth might include training to become a qualified dispensing optician, specialising in contact lenses, or moving into practice management. Comprehensive training is frequently provided, encompassing on-the-job learning and support for formal qualifications like NVQs.
